Each tool addresses a completely distinct forensic task: file metadata/hash, string extraction with indicator scanning, and memory dump analysis. There is no functional overlap, so agents can easily select the right tool.
All tool names follow the same verb-noun pattern with lowercase and hyphens (extract-metadata, extract-strings, analyze-memory-dump). The naming is perfectly consistent and predictable.
Three tools is on the lower end but still within a reasonable range for a focused forensic artifact investigator. The count is just slightly under what might be expected, but each tool covers a major area.
The toolset covers core forensic workflows: file metadata/hash analysis, string/indicator extraction, and memory dump analysis. Minor gaps exist (e.g., no timeline or registry parsing), but the essential artifact types are addressed.
